The ECHO:

A Son and his father are walking in the mountains, suddenly, the son falls , hurts himself and screams; "AAAhhhhhhhhhh!!!" To his surprise, he hears a voice repeating, somewhere in the mountains: "AAAhhhhhhh!!!" curious , he shouts out "Who are you ?" He receives the answer "Who are you" And then he shouts at the mountain "I admire you !" The voice answers "I admire you!" Angered at the response he shouts "Coward!" He receives the answer"Coward! "He look sto his father and asks whats going on? The father smiles and says:"My son pay attention" Again the man shouts "You are a champion!" The boy is surprised but does not understand. Then his father explains "People call this the echo, but really this is life. It gives you back everything you say or do, Our life is simply a reflection of our actions. If you want more love in the world create more love in your heart. If you want more competency in your team, improve your own competency. This relationship applies to everything, in all aspects of life,Life will give you back everything you have given to it. Your life is not a coincidence.Its a reflection of you!".
